24 Commits (master)

Author SHA1 Message Date
Jimmy Brisson 491832fedf fix(arm): check the presence of the policy check function 5 months ago
Sughosh Ganu 6aaf257de4 feat(fwu): pass a const metadata structure to platform routines 3 years ago
Manish V Badarkhe 2f1177b2b9 feat(plat/arm): add FWU support in Arm platforms 3 years ago
Manish V Badarkhe ef1daa420f feat(plat/arm): add GPT parser support 4 years ago
Sandrine Bailleux afe62624c3 Check for out-of-bound accesses in the platform io policies 5 years ago
Louis Mayencourt a6de824f7e fconf: Clean Arm IO 5 years ago
Louis Mayencourt 9739982125 arm-io: Panic in case of io setup failure 5 years ago
Louis Mayencourt d6dcbcad18 MISRA fix: Use boolean essential type 5 years ago
Antonio Nino Diaz bd9344f670 plat/arm: Sanitise includes 6 years ago
Antonio Nino Diaz 09d40e0e08 Sanitise includes across codebase 6 years ago
Soby Mathew 1d71ba141d FVP: Add dummy configs for BL31, BL32 and BL33 7 years ago
Roberto Vargas 1af540ef2a Fix MISRA rule 8.4 Part 1 7 years ago
Soby Mathew cab0b5b045 ARM Platforms: Load HW_CONFIG in BL2 7 years ago
Soby Mathew c228956afa ARM Platorms: Load TB_FW_CONFIG in BL1 7 years ago
Summer Qin 71fb396440 Support Trusted OS firmware extra images in TF tools 8 years ago
dp-arm 82cb2c1ad9 Use SPDX license identifiers 8 years ago
Sandrine Bailleux ed81f3ebbf Introduce utils.h header file 8 years ago
Soren Brinkmann 65cd299f52 Remove direct usage of __attribute__((foo)) 9 years ago
Juan Castillo f59821d512 Replace all SCP FW (BL0, BL3-0) references 9 years ago
Juan Castillo 516beb585c TBB: apply TBBR naming convention to certificates and extensions 9 years ago
Yatharth Kochar 436223def6 FWU: Add Firmware Update support in BL1 for ARM platforms 9 years ago
Juan Castillo e098e244a2 Remove deprecated IO return definitions 9 years ago
Juan Castillo 16948ae1d9 Use numbers to identify images instead of names 10 years ago
Dan Handley b4315306ad Add common ARM and CSS platform code 10 years ago
Juan Castillo dec840af4b TBB: authenticate BL3-x images and certificates 10 years ago
Juan Castillo 01df3c1467 TBB: authenticate BL2 image and certificate 10 years ago
Sandrine Bailleux edfda10a6b Juno: Add support for Test Secure-EL1 Payload 10 years ago
Sandrine Bailleux 01b916bff2 Juno: Implement initial platform port 10 years ago
Dan Handley 6d16ce0bfe Remove redundant io_init() function 10 years ago
Dan Handley 6ad2e461f0 Rationalize console log output 10 years ago
Dan Handley 17a387ad5a Rename FVP specific files and functions 11 years ago
Dan Handley 5f0cdb059d Split platform.h into separate headers 11 years ago
Dan Handley 625de1d4f0 Remove variables from .data section 11 years ago
Dan Handley 97043ac98e Reduce deep nesting of header files 11 years ago
Dan Handley fb037bfb7c Always use named structs in header files 11 years ago
Dan Handley 35e98e5588 Make use of user/system includes more consistent 11 years ago
Sandrine Bailleux 886278e55f Semihosting: Fix file mode to load binaries on Windows 11 years ago
Ryan Harkin 48e2ca7967 fvp: plat_io_storage: remove duplicated code 11 years ago
Jeenu Viswambharan 08c28d5385 Report recoverable errors as warnings 11 years ago
Achin Gupta 375f538a79 Add Test Secure Payload Dispatcher (TSPD) service 11 years ago
Harry Liebel 561cd33ece Add Firmware Image Package (FIP) driver 11 years ago
James Morrissey 9d72b4ea9c Implement load_image in terms of IO abstraction 11 years ago